About This Audiobook

*Winter’s Law* isn’t just another legal thriller—it’s a razor-sharp dissection of how the past claws its way into the present. Stephen Penner drops us into the life of Michael Jameson, a man who’s spent two decades building a flawless façade: devoted husband, doting father, respected professional. Then, with surgical precision, the story rips it all away when a quarter-century-old murder charge resurfaces, tied to a gangland deal gone wrong. What follows isn’t just a trial; it’s a psychological pressure cooker where every witness, every piece of evidence, and every legal maneuver forces Michael—and the listener—to question what justice even means when the system itself is the adversary.

Talon David’s narration is the secret weapon here. His delivery walks the tightrope between weary gravitas and simmering rage, mirroring Michael’s unraveling composure. The audiobook thrives on its pacing: lean, methodical, but punctuated by courtroom explosions that’ll have you rewinding to catch every verbal jab. Unlike thrillers that rely on twist-after-twist, *Winter’s Law* hooks you with its moral ambiguity—this isn’t about *if* Michael did it, but *why* it matters now, and who benefits from digging up old bones. The legal procedural elements are meticulously researched, but the heart of the story beats in the quiet moments, where a glance between spouses or a lawyer’s pause speaks volumes.

Editor's Review ★★★★☆

AudioBook Atlas

I’ll admit, I rolled my eyes at first. Another middle-aged man with a secret past? But *Winter’s Law* disarmed me within chapters. Penner’s writing cuts through thriller clichés by making Michael Jameson deeply, *uncomfortably* human. This isn’t a hero or a villain—it’s a man who’s spent 25 years outrunning his younger self, and the audiobook forces you to sit in that discomfort with him. Talon David’s performance is a masterclass in restraint; he doesn’t overplay the drama, which makes the rare outbursts (like Michael’s confrontation with an old gang associate) land like gut punches. The courtroom scenes, in particular, crackle with authenticity—Penner’s legal background shows, but he never lets jargon bog down the tension. That said, the flashbacks to the ’90s drug deal occasionally feel *too* polished, like they’ve been sanded down for clarity when a little more grit might’ve heightened the stakes. And while the supporting cast is strong, a few side characters (Michael’s wife, his defense attorney) sometimes blur into archetypes when the story pivots back to the central mystery. Still, the audiobook’s production is flawless—no distracting edits, no uneven volume—and the final act’s moral ambiguity will haunt you long after the credits roll. If you’re tired of thrillers that tie everything up in a neat bow, *Winter’s Law* is the antidote: a story that asks whether the truth is worth the cost of uncovering it, narrated by someone who makes every doubt feel personal.
